LONDON (AFX) - Glow Communications PLC said it full year operating loss narrowed slightly as turnover surged 64 pct and it predicted profitability in the near future if its sales performance remains on track.

The operating loss narrowed to 3.5 mln stg in the year to Nov 30 from 3.7 mln a year earlier as turnover rose 64 pct to 8.3 mln stg from 5.1 mln.

Like-for-like turnover, which excludes the group's Primary Networks operation that was disposed of in 2001, rose 98 pct.

But at the pretax level, losses widened to 4.1 mln stg from 3.5 mln in the year.

"The substantial progress made during the last twelve months is only partially reflected in these results," said chairman Derek Griffiths. "Our principal subsidiary, Glow Telecom, has enjoyed considerable success in terms of customer acquisition and increasing the revenue derived from them."

"Our data storage subsidiary, Primary Storage, continues to trade in line with expectations, and following the well-received launch of its latest Mac product, the company's prospects look more encouraging than they have done for some time."

The chairman said that overall he is "confident of the company's prospects going forward."

Turnover from the group's telecoms operations rose sharply to 4.7 mln stg in the year from 231,411 stg a year earlier, with most of this growth occurring during the second half of the year, with what the company called "a minimal increase in overhead".

"The continuing monthly growth in organic sales, combined with the established tight control of the cost base, will enable the group to achieve positive returns in the very near future," said Griffiths.

Glow Telecom saw its average revenue per user during the year rise to 51.73 stg per month for business customers and 11.58 stg per month for residential customers and total registered active accounts for the year rose 788 pct to 21,216.

signed an agreement with Atlantic Electric and Gas. Under the terms of the agreement Glow, which already specialises in the development and provision of low-cost high-quality telecommunications services, will initially market a low cost electricity and gas energy offering to its existing telecoms customers base. The second stage of the agreement will enable Glow to use its proven marketing affinity strategy to sell a wider range of low cost energy services to new customers. Atlantic is an independent electricity and gas supplier in the UK. Atlantic will initially manage all new customers in terms of response to advertising, inbound sales, migration from other suppliers and after care.
